CBR40 Xfinity Upload Speed Droppped
I started with Xfinity provided modem/router with new service 1000 Mbps. I used the provided modem/router for a week worked perfectly. I have two desktops wired and a iPhone. In that first week I ran SpeedTest on SpeedTest App on all devices & desktops. I was usually getting 900 Mbps down / 40 Mbps up on desktops and about 500 Mbps / 30 Mbps on iPhone.
I was trying to improve the coverage to work in the downstairs area and bought the Orbi CBR40. Instation went fine, except my Speeds on same desktop and devices have dropped. Desktops now about 725 Mbps / 6 Mbps & iPhone 500 / 5 Mbps. The download speeds are fine its the upload on all devices (wired & wireless that has dropped from 40 Mbps to 6 Mbps. Again same cables, devices, desktops, etc. I even unhooked and rehooked the same wires, devices, etc to Xfinity rental unit and the upload speed went back up to 40 Mbps.
The setup is Cable (Xfinity) into Orbi CBR40>wired directly to desktop.

Have the ISP check the signal and line quality UP to the modem.
Be sure there are no coax cable line splitters in the between the modem and ISP service box.
Be sure your using good quality RG6 coax cable up to the modem.What FW is currently loaded on the CBR40...
Be sure your speed testing with just 1 wired PC connected and no other devices connected or streaming when your speed testing.
Be sure Armor and Circle, QoS Access Control or Traffic Meter is not enabled.
